Alabama lawmakers on Thursday advanced legislation that could see librarians prosecuted under the state's obscenity law for providing "harmful" materials to minors, the latest in a wave of bills in Republican-led states targeting library content and decisions. The Alabama House of Representatives voted 72-28 for the bill that now moves to the Alabama Senate. The legislation comes amid a soaring number of book challenges — often centered on LGBTQ content — and efforts in a number of states to ban...
